Dying Matters Awareness Week Starts May 13 in the U.K.

2019 Dying Matters Awareness Week events map. Every year in May, Dying Matters Awareness Week takes place in the United Kingdom and Wales. The week of activities get people talking about dying, death and bereavement, and places the topic front and center on the national agenda. In 2019, Dying Matters Awareness Week runs from the 13th to the 19th of May. The theme for 2019 is "Are We Ready?" If U.S. statistics are any indication, most people are...

How Grief is Like Driving on Your Emergency Spare Tire

An emergency spare tire, a.k.a. "donut" tire. Have you ever had to use the emergency spare tire on your automobile? It's smaller than your regular tires. As a result, you have to change your driving habits when you rely on this emergency "donut" tire. Experiencing grief and mourning is a lot like driving around on your spare tire. Consider: You have to slow down. The emergency spare tire's label warns you to keep your speed below 50 miles per...

New Mexico Before I Die Festival Wins National Funeral Industry Award

The 2018 Before I Die New Mexico Festival is being recognized with a prestigious national funeral industry award. A Good Goodbye from Albuquerque, New Mexico, has won First Place in the International Cemetery, Cremation and Funeral Association’s 2018 Keeping It Personal (KIP) Awards. The KIP Award recognizes the best in personalization in the cemetery, funeral service and cremation profession.

Fun Photos from Frozen Dead Guy Days

The 2019 Frozen Dead Guy Days festival in Nederland, Colorado drew a record-breaking 20-25,000 attendees March 8-10. In our little corner of the festival, we had 1,200 people come to watch the 1998 Robin Beeck documentary “Grandpa’s in the TUFF Shed” and play (or watch others play) The Newly-Dead Game®.
